The Morning Show – August 19, 2009

The Morning Show gets an update on the Election in Afghanistan. Then David Bacon, labor correspondent talks with guests about the Hotel Workers' contract which is up for renegotiation. In the second hour Chip Berlet, senior analyst of Political Research Associates and co-author of "Right-Wing Populism in America: Too Close for Comfort." looks at the phenomena of conservative activists storming town hall meetings. Then director Dr. Sarab Singh Neelam discusses his film “Ocean of Pearls”.
